Origin and History
This grenadier battalion was created in 1761.
During the Seven Years' War, the battalion was commanded by:
- 1761: colonel Christian Friedrich von Heimburg
The regiment was diabanded in 1767.
Service during the War
The regiment did not see active service during the Seven Years War.
